使用capistrano和git进行部署时,引用不是树错误

时间:2010-12-14 21:23:03

标签: ruby-on-rails git capistrano

我能够为某个应用程序做一段时间的capistrano部署,但最近我不能再部署git whines:“致命:引用不是树:a84 ......”。我不知道我做了什么,我不认为我改变了部署文件,我没有使用git子模块,并且十六进制引用对应于我做的最新提交。

由于

2 个答案:

答案 0 :(得分:3)

您可能需要确保实际将此分支推送到远程存储库,而不仅仅是将其提交。

同时检查capistrano是否在config / deploy.rb文件中查看相同的分支

set :branch, "master"

答案 1 :(得分:0)

我不知道为什么但是将域名从IP地址更改为我的域名解决了这个问题。